Chris Simms is known for his powerful arm and his role in some of the Longhorns' biggest games. Fans appreciate his competitive nature and the excitement he brought to the game, despite the ups and downs of his career at Texas.
Major Applewhite is beloved for his gritty performances and remarkable leadership on the field. Fans admire his underdog spirit and how he consistently exceeded expectations, creating memorable and game-winning plays that have left a lasting impression.
Chris Simms and Major Applewhite represent two very distinct eras in University of Texas football, sparking intense debates among fans who resonate with their unique styles and achievements during their collegiate careers.
